1.3 ICT Technician-E-learning Coordinator

JOB PURPOSE:

The ideal candidate will be responsible for supporting and maintaining the university’s ICT infrastructure, with a particular focus on e-learning systems, content design, and the use of graphic software. This role requires a blend of technical skills, instructional design, and the ability to work with academic staff and students to ensure effective use of e-learning technologies.

PRINCIPAL ACCOUNTABILITIES:

i. Manage and support the university’s e-learning platforms (e.g., Moodle. Blackboard) and associated technologies.

ii. Assist academic staff in the development and integration of digital content and online resources.

iii. Design and develop engaging e-learning content, ensuring it meets pedagogical standards and best practices.

iv. Utilize graphic design software to create visually appealing e-learning materials.

vi. Provide technical support and maintenance for the university’s ICT infrastructure, including hardware, software, and network systems.

QUALIFICATIONS AND PERSONAL ATTRIBUTES:

i.Full Grade 12 Certificate with a minimum of five (5) credits, including English and Mathematics.

ii. Degree in Computer Science or information technology.

iii. Relevant certifications/Skills (HTML, CSS, Javascript, bootstrap, linux).

iv. Member ICTAZ/EIZ.
